The update focuses heavily on balancing the roster after the initial post-launch meta settled. 1. Character Balance Adjustments

On the fighting front, while it wasn't a major balance overhaul, v1.10.01 included small but impactful adjustments for several characters, including Bryan Fury, Paul Phoenix, Eddy Gordo, and Heihachi Mishima, primarily focusing on hitbox and collision detection fixes.
